Ansimov
@Ansimov
Веб-разработка, Веб-дизайн, Графический дизайн

Массив данных в Javascript полученный через json_encode?

Есть база данных, содержащая "Номер скидочного купона" и "срок действия купона".
Из PHP передаю массив двух значений в Javascript

$data = mysql_query("SELECT Coupon_ID, Issue_Date FROM Coupon_List WHERE Coupon_ID='$uniqid'",$db);   //
$row = mysql_fetch_array($data);
echo json_encode($row);


Как теперь в Javascript использовать полученные данные?
Как вставить значения массива в разные DIV поля?

<script type="text/javascript">
$(document).ready(function(){
  $("#submit").click(function(){
   $.post('UniqID.php', function(data){
    $("#a").html(data);
    $("#b").html(data);
    });
    });
    });
</script>
</head>
<body>
  
  <button id="submit">Отправить!</button>
  <div id="a"></div>
  <div id="b"></div>

</body>
  • Вопрос задан
  • 373 просмотра
Решения вопроса 1
@stasov1
Нужно строку json парсить в js-объект
$(document).ready(function(){
  $("#submit").click(function(){
   $.post('UniqID.php', function(data){
   var json = $.parseJSON(data);
    $("#a").html(json.номер_купона);
    $("#b").html(json.время_действия_купона);
    });
    });
    });


Или без строки var json .... , точно не помню
Ответ написан
Пригласить эксперта
Ответы на вопрос 1
@semki096
json и шаблонизатор handlebars
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ы
22 нояб. 2024, в 22:26
3500 руб./за проект
22 нояб. 2024, в 21:47
3000 руб./за проект
22 нояб. 2024, в 21:44
50000 руб./за проект